PURPOSE:To obtain the polarization maintaining optical fiber coil having the fiber sectional shape with an arbitrary polarization maintaining characteristic by applying a solvent layer contg. specific metals in the spacing between an optical fiber and the outer inner periphery of a cylinder, and subjecting the fiber to a heat treatment. CONSTITUTION:The solvent contg. the uni- to bivalent metals is previously applied on the outside surface of the cylinder type frame 14 before the single mode optical fiber 11 and is wound on the cylinder type frame 14. The single mode optical fiber 11 is then wound on this applied solvent and is subjected to the heat treatment to diffuse the uni- to bivalent metals onto the surface of the single mode optical fiber 11, by which a univalent metal ion-diffused layer 17 is constituted. For example, Ag is used as the metal and, for example, butyl acetate is used as the solvent. The viscosity is specified to 1000 to 10000 centipoises. The uni- to bivalent metals are diffused as metal ions into the clad of the single mode optical fiber 11 when the system formed in such a manner is rested for 30 minutes to 3 hours in the constant temp. of 140 to 350 deg.C. |
